英特爾虛擬RAID on CPU(VROC)代表了伺服器儲存管理的一次突破性變革,它消除了傳統RAID控制卡的需求,同時利用CPU資源提升儲存效能。這項技術對現代資料中心和伺服器租用環境變得越來越重要,特別是在需要高效能儲存解決方案的場景中。隨著企業持續面臨日益增長的資料管理挑戰,VROC作為一種變革性解決方案,從根本上重新構想了儲存架構,同時提供企業級可靠性和效能優化。

理解英特爾VROC技術

從本質上講,英特爾VROC是一項創新的儲存技術,它能夠通過CPU直接配置NVMe SSD的RAID陣列,無需傳統的RAID控制卡。這種直接由CPU管理的方式徹底改變了企業處理伺服器基礎設施儲存的方式。該技術利用英特爾至強處理器的處理能力和PCIe通道,提供前所未有的儲存效能,同時顯著降低了系統複雜性和硬體需求。

  • 直接CPU整合:利用CPU PCIe通道進行儲存管理,與傳統解決方案相比,資料處理速度提升高達6.5倍
  • NVMe支援:針對高速NVMe儲存裝置最佳化,支援最新的PCIe Gen 4和Gen 5規範
  • 硬體要求:相容英特爾至強處理器和特定晶片組,支援最新伺服器平台
  • 靈活性:支援各種RAID配置(0、1、5、10),具有動態容量擴展功能

技術架構和元件

英特爾VROC的架構由多個關鍵元件組成,它們協同工作以提供最佳儲存效能。每個元素都經過精心設計,以確保最大效率和可靠性,同時保持與現有基礎設施的無縫整合。這種複雜的架構實現了前所未有的儲存效能,同時顯著降低了系統複雜性。

  • VMD(磁碟區管理裝置)控制器:
    • 通過PCIe通道管理NVMe磁碟機,具備進階錯誤處理功能
    • 支援熱插拔功能和意外移除保護
    • 支援即時監控和健康狀態報告
  • 英特爾RSTe驅動程式:
    • 處理RAID配置和管理,具有企業級可靠性
    • 提供進階資料保護機制
    • 提供智慧快取演算法以優化效能
  • 硬體金鑰:
    • 用於啟用進階RAID模式的可選元件
    • 提供額外的安全功能和加密功能
    • 為企業部署啟用進階功能
  • PCIe基礎設施:
    • CPU和NVMe磁碟機之間的直接連接,實現最低延遲
    • 支援最新的PCIe規範以獲得最大頻寬
    • 支援儲存資源的靈活擴展

效能優勢和優點

VROC技術的實施為伺服器儲存系統帶來了顯著的效能提升,從根本上改變了資料中心處理儲存架構的方式。通過廣泛的測試和實際部署,VROC相比傳統儲存解決方案展現出顯著優勢:

  • 降低延遲:
    • CPU到儲存的直接通訊路徑最大限度地減少資料傳輸延遲
    • 與傳統RAID控制器相比,延遲降低高達70%
    • 最佳化的I/O處理提升應用程式回應時間
  • 提升輸送量:
    • 在最佳配置下,多個NVMe磁碟機可達到28GB/s
    • 通過額外磁碟機整合實現可擴展效能
    • 改進的平行處理能力
  • 降低總擁有成本:
    • 消除昂貴的RAID控制卡降低硬體成本
    • 通過高效的資源利用降低功耗
    • 降低維護和散熱需求
  • 簡化管理:
    • 整合的儲存管理介面,具有直觀的控制功能
    • 集中化監控和管理功能
    • 簡化的部署和配置流程

實施場景和使用案例

英特爾VROC的多功能性使其在各種伺服器部署場景中特別有價值,在要求嚴格的企業環境中展現出卓越效能。該技術的適應性和強大的功能集使其能夠滿足多個產業領域的多樣化運算和儲存需求:

  • 高效能運算(HPC)環境:
    • 具有大規模資料處理需求的科學運算應用
    • AI和機器學習工作負載的即時資料處理
    • 需要最小I/O延遲的複雜運算工作負載
    • 處理大型資料集和模擬的研究機構
  • 企業資料中心:
    • 具有動態資源分配的虛擬機託管
    • 需要高IOPS的資料庫管理系統
    • 要求微秒級回應時間的高頻交易平台
    • 處理PB級資料集的大數據分析平台
  • 雲端服務提供商:
    • 需要強大隔離的多租戶託管環境
    • 雲原生應用的可擴展儲存解決方案
    • 具有不同效能需求的混合雲部署

部署和配置指南

實施英特爾VROC需要仔細規劃並考慮幾個關鍵因素。成功部署需要充分準備、適當的硬體選擇和最佳配置設定,以確保最大效能和可靠性:

  • 硬體先決條件:
    • 相容的英特爾至強處理器(第三代或更新版本)
    • 支援的主機板晶片組,並具有最新韌體更新
    • 具有適當韌體版本的企業級NVMe SSD
    • 用於啟用RAID 5/50/6/60配置的VROC硬體金鑰
    • 充足的電源供應和散熱基礎設施
  • 配置步驟:
    • BIOS配置和VMD啟用:
      • 在BIOS設定中啟用英特爾VMD支援
      • 根據需要配置PCIe插槽分叉
      • 最佳化電源管理設定
    • 驅動程式安裝和更新:
      • 安裝最新的英特爾RSTe驅動程式
      • 配置驅動程式參數以獲得最佳效能
      • 實施必要的安全修補程式
    • RAID陣列設定和最佳化:
      • 根據需求選擇適當的RAID層級
      • 配置條帶大小和快取設定
      • 實施熱備援策略
    • 效能測試和驗證:
      • 進行基準效能測量
      • 驗證冗餘和容錯轉移功能
      • 記錄配置設定和效能指標

效能最佳化策略

為了在伺服器環境中最大化VROC效能,請考慮以下全面的最佳化技術。每種策略都經過廣泛測試和實際部署驗證,確保在各種工作負載場景下實現最佳效能:

  • 策略性磁碟機配置:
    • 平衡PCIe通道分配:
      • 最佳化CPU到磁碟機的連接
      • 確保陣列間的通道均衡分配
      • 考慮多插槽系統的NUMA拓撲
    • 最佳化散熱管理:
      • 實施適當的氣流模式
      • 監控負載下的磁碟機溫度
      • 配置散熱限制閾值
    • 考慮頻寬分配:
      • 分析工作負載模式
      • 有效分配I/O負載
      • 根據需要實施QoS策略
  • RAID配置選擇:
    • RAID 0用於最大效能:
      • 適用於暫存資料和快取磁碟機
      • 支援高達35GB/s的循序讀取速度
      • 最適合效能關鍵型應用程式
    • RAID 1用於關鍵資料保護:
      • 適用於作業系統磁碟機
      • 提供完全冗餘,開銷最小
      • 支援熱插拔功能
    • RAID 5用於平衡效能:
      • 適用於混合工作負載環境
      • 提供資料保護和高效儲存利用
      • 支援線上容量擴展
    • RAID 10用於高可用性:
      • 適用於關鍵任務資料庫
      • 結合效能和冗餘優勢
      • 支援快速重建操作

與傳統解決方案的比較分析

在將英特爾VROC與傳統RAID解決方案進行評估時,顯現出幾個關鍵差異,在效能、成本效益和運營效率方面展現出顯著優勢:

  • 效能指標:
    • 比硬體RAID高25%的輸送量:
      • 循序讀取效能高達35GB/s
      • 隨機讀取IOPS超過700萬
      • 在重負載下保持穩定效能
    • 典型工作負載延遲降低40%:
      • 亞微秒級回應時間
      • 減少I/O瓶頸
      • 提升應用程式回應能力
    • 改進的CPU資源利用:
      • 更好的快取利用
      • 最佳化的中斷處理
      • 減少上下文切換開銷
  • 成本考慮:
    • 消除專用RAID控制器成本:
      • 降低硬體支出
      • 降低維護成本
      • 簡化備件管理
    • 降低功耗:
      • 功耗降低高達30%
      • 提高散熱效率
      • 降低製冷需求

未來發展和產業趨勢

英特爾VROC技術的發展持續塑造著伺服器儲存的未來,多個新興趨勢和發展將進一步改變資料中心架構:

  • 新興功能:
    • 強化的PCIe Gen 5支援:
      • 比Gen 4頻寬翻倍
      • 改進的能效演算法
      • 強化的訊號完整性特性
    • 改進的VMD架構:
      • 進階錯誤處理機制
      • 強化的監控能力
      • 擴展的裝置支援矩陣
    • 進階加密特性:
      • 硬體加速加密
      • 強化的金鑰管理
      • 符合最新安全標準
  • 產業整合:
    • 更廣泛的OEM採用:
      • 擴展的伺服器平台支援
      • 整合管理解決方案
      • 標準化部署框架
    • 雲端基礎設施實施:
      • 原生雲端儲存整合
      • 多雲部署支援
      • 混合雲最佳化
    • 邊緣運算部署:
      • 針對邊緣伺服器配置最佳化
      • 降低邊緣應用延遲
      • 強化的遠端管理能力

實際實施建議

為了在伺服器租用和伺服器託管環境中實現最佳VROC部署,請考慮以下確保最大效能和可靠性的全面最佳實務:

  • 所有元件的定期韌體更新:
    • 自動更新排程
    • 版本相容性驗證
    • 回復程序文件
  • 全面監控系統實施:
    • 即時效能追蹤
    • 預測性故障分析
    • 自動化警報系統
  • 備份策略制定:
    • 定期備份排程
    • 復原時間目標(RTO)規劃
    • 災難復原程序
  • 效能基準建立:
    • 基準測試程序
    • 效能指標文件
    • 容量規劃指南

結論

英特爾VROC代表了伺服器儲存技術的重大進步,為現代資料中心和伺服器租用環境提供了令人信服的優勢。通過消除傳統RAID控制器的同時保持企業級儲存效能和可靠性,VROC技術繼續推動伺服器基礎設施設計和管理的創新。該技術能夠提供卓越效能、降低複雜性和提高成本效率,使其成為尋求最佳化儲存基礎設施的組織的越來越具有吸引力的解決方案。

對於考慮伺服器儲存解決方案的組織而言,英特爾VROC提供了一種前瞻性方法,平衡了效能、成本和可靠性。隨著技術的不斷發展,其在塑造資料中心儲存架構未來方面的角色變得越來越重要,特別是在儲存效能直接影響服務品質的伺服器租用和伺服器託管環境中。VROC功能的持續發展,加上不斷增長的產業採用率,使這項技術成為下一代儲存基礎設施的基石。